**What are Medical Billing Associations?**
Medical billing associations are organizations that bring together professionals from the medical billing and coding industry. These associations typically offer a variety of resources, such as education and training materials, networking opportunities, certification programs, and advocacy for the profession. By joining a medical billing association, professionals can stay up-to-date with industry trends, connect with peers, and access valuable resources to enhance their skills and career prospects.
**Why are Medical Billing Associations Important?**
Medical billing associations play a vital role in the healthcare industry by providing support and resources to professionals in the field. Some key reasons why medical billing associations are important include:
1. **Education and Training:** Medical billing associations offer a wide range of educational resources, including online courses, webinars, and workshops, to help professionals stay current with industry trends and regulations.
2. **Networking Opportunities:** Associations provide a platform for professionals to connect with peers, share best practices, and build valuable relationships within the industry.
3. **Certification Programs:** Many medical billing associations offer certification programs to help professionals demonstrate their expertise and enhance their credibility in the field.
4. **Advocacy:** Associations advocate for the interests of medical billing professionals, working to promote the profession and support its members in their professional development.
**How to Choose the Right Medical Billing Association**
With so many medical billing associations to choose from, it can be challenging to find the right one for your needs. Here are some key factors to consider when selecting a medical billing association:
1. **Membership Benefits:** Look for associations that offer a wide range of benefits, such as education and training resources, networking opportunities, certification programs, and advocacy for the profession.
2. **Reputation:** Consider the reputation of the association within the industry, as well as the quality of its programs and resources.
3. **Cost:** Evaluate the cost of membership and determine whether the benefits offered justify the investment.
4. **Industry Focus:** Choose an association that is aligned with your specific interests and career goals within the medical billing and coding field.

**Practical Tips for Getting the Most Out of Your Membership**
To maximize the benefits of your membership in a medical billing association, consider the following tips:
1. **Attend Events:** Participate in webinars, workshops, and conferences to stay current with industry trends and build your network.
2. **Get Involved:** Volunteer for committees or leadership positions within the association to make a meaningful contribution and expand your opportunities for growth.
3. **Stay Informed:** Keep up-to-date with newsletters, publications, and resources provided by the association to stay informed on industry news and best practices.
4. **Utilize Resources:** Take advantage of educational materials, certification programs, and advocacy efforts offered by the association to enhance your skills and advance your career.
